What did you spend your second transfer on?
I used my first transfer to buy 30 iron sheets KES 21000, 20 bags of cement KES 16000 and bought 2 cows KES 25000. I topped up KES 12300 from merry-go-round group.
Describe the biggest difference in your daily life.
I never thought i would afford a new house as a widow but GD has given me a lifetime opportunity to build a new house I am so thankful and relieved.

What did you spend your first transfer on?
l bought two mattress one for my children at 2800 kshs the other one was mine which was 5000 kshs the balance l use for transport.
What are you planning to spend your upcoming transfer on?
l am planning to extend my house and to buy furniture.

What are you planning to spend your transfer on?
I plan to use the transfer to expand my house to accommodate my family. I plan to build a toilet for the family. I also plan to start a small business to boost my income.
What is the achievement you are proudest of?
My proudest achievement is that I have been able to build a house for my family however small it is. In the past I used to stay in a rental house but I managed to do this from my savings.
What is the biggest hardship you've faced in your life?
The biggest hardship that I have faced in my life is when I lost my husband. He used to be the sole bread winner for the family.
What is the happiest part of your day?
My happiest part of the day is in the morning when I take breakfast with my children.
